... Read moreIn exploring how God speaks to us, the Bible presents various methods that are both natural and supernatural. For instance, whispers can serve as intimate counsel guiding us through life's decisions, as demonstrated in 1 Kings 19:12, where God’s voice came in a gentle whisper. Additionally, dreams play a significant role in divine communication, with figures like Joseph interpreting dreams to unveil God’s will (Genesis 37:5-10). Visions, as mentioned in Acts 2:17, reveal God’s plans and intentions, often providing clarity in confusing times. The Holy Spirit acts as our counselor, imparting messages to our hearts and minds. Throughout scripture, manifestations such as the burning bush in Exodus 3:1-4 highlight moments of divine encounter. God may also communicate through circumstances, as seen in the story of Jonah; the trials he faced were pivotal in directing him to fulfill God’s mission. In summary, whether through scripture, personal experiences, or spiritual revelations, understanding these various channels can enhance your spiritual journey and relationship with the divine.
